
Real Estate Lawyers in New Jersey
Real estate lawyers in New Jersey play a crucial role in navigating the complexities of property transactions in the Garden State. Whether you are a buyer, seller, landlord, tenant, or real estate investor, having an experienced attorney on your side can help protect your interests and ensure a smooth and legally compliant transaction.
One of the primary responsibilities of real estate lawyers in New Jersey is to review and draft contracts for real estate transactions. These legal professionals have an in-depth understanding of New Jersey real estate laws and regulations and can ensure that the terms of the contract are fair and in compliance with the law. They can also assist in negotiations to help you achieve your goals and protect your rights throughout the process.
In addition to contract review and drafting, real estate lawyers in New Jersey can also conduct title searches to uncover any potential issues with the property's ownership history. This can help prevent legal disputes or financial liabilities down the line. They also help with due diligence, ensuring that all necessary inspections, permits, and zoning requirements are in place before closing the deal.
If disputes arise during a real estate transaction, whether it be related to breach of contract, property boundaries, or other issues, real estate lawyers in New Jersey can provide legal representation and help resolve the conflict through negotiation, mediation, or litigation if necessary.
